Solution Overview

Problem

Advertisers face challenges in correlating online user activity with specific broadcast advertisements in real-time, limiting their ability to adjust online advertising effectively and understand the impact of broadcast advertising on online engagement.

Innovation Solution

A system that uses inaudible audio watermarks or unique identifiers embedded in broadcast signals to detect commercial messages, allowing for real-time adjustments to online advertising settings, such as bid amounts, geolocation targeting, and ad placement, to maximize online engagement during and after the broadcast.

Data Source

PatentUS11544748B2Online advertising and promotional coordination system
Publication Date: 2023.01.03 VEIL GLOBAL TECHNOLOGIES INC

AI summary

A system and method receive a first signal at one or more processors of a promotional system that indicates automatic detection of presentation of a commercial, determine one or more online advertising settings associated with at least one of a product, service, or entity of interest in the commercial that was detected, and determine a current setting for the one or more online advertising settings from a search engine system. The online advertising settings are associated with a website of interest of the at least one of the product, service, or entity of interest. The system and method also send a second signal to the search engine system that temporarily changes the one or more online advertising settings during a time period following detection of the presentation of the commercial.
